The ISI Essential Science Indicators have identified the paper "On sequential Monte Carlo sampling methods for Bayesian filtering" by A. Doucet, S. Godsill and C. Andrieu (Stats. and Computing, 10, pp.197-208, 2000) as a 'Fast Breaking Paper'.

This scheme identifies very recent scientific contributions that have received especially large increases in numbers of citations over bi-monthly periods. See http://esi-topics.com/fbp/fbp-june2002.html for details and an interview with the first author Arnaud Doucet.

Arnaud Doucet worked for three years as a Research Associate in the Signal Processing Group, then took up a Senior Lectureship at University of Melbourne. He returns to CUED in September as a University Lecturer.
